Overview
Heritage Conservancy seeks a dynamic and effective leader to serve as Director or Senior Director of
Finance and Administration.
D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
Core responsibilities of this position will include:
Financial Management, including:
Oversee financial tracking and reporting (internal and external)
Supervise Accounting Manager and Grants Manager
Human Resources Management, including:
Update and maintain Policies / Employee Handbook
Lead review of employee compensation and benefits
Oversee Hiring / Onboarding
Office Management, including:
Supervise Program Coordinator
Facilities Management, including:
Oversee relationship with caterer for events at Historic Aldie
Depending on the nature and level of the successful applicant’s skills and experience, this position may
also include one or more of the following responsibilities:
IT Management, including:
Oversee relationship with IT vendors
Risk Management, including:
Manage both insurable and cyber risks
Oversee relationship with insurance broker and IT vendors
Working with the Conservancy’s Board of Directors, including its Finance, Audit, Human
Resources, and/or Facilities Committees
The Director or Senior Director of Finance and Administration will report to the Conservancy’s President.
This is a full-time position based in Heritage Conservancy’s office in Doylestown, PA.
